NDPS – Bail – Involvement of accused no.2 in view of statement of accused no.1 under Section 67 of NDPS Act.  No possession or recovery of contraband from applicant-accused no.2

On 3.2.2023, the accused no.1 was arrested for the offences under NDPS Act.  In his statement under Section 67 of  NDPS Act, the accused nos.2 and 3 were alleged to have been involved in the crime.  However, there was no possession or recovery of contraband from the applicant – accused no.2.  There is no direct evidence of money trail or contact with accused no.1.

HELD that the confession / voluntary statement of accused no.1 under Section 67 is inadmissible and therefore, the arrest made on the basis of such inadmissible evidence is not legal. However, there was no possession or recovery of contraband from the applicant – accused no.2.  There is no direct evidence of money trail or contact with accused no.1. Considerations for bail are whether the Court is satisfied that there are reasonable grounds to believe that he is not guilty of such offence and that he is not likely to commit any offence while on bail.   There are no criminal antecedents against the applicant – accused no.2 under NDPS Act.  

Order dated 17.4.2024 in Criminal Bail Application No.2894 of 2023 of Saddam Hussain Qureshi Vs. Union of India and another
